The World's First Foldable Steering Wheel
In partnership with Autoliv, we’ve launched the world’s first production-ready foldable steering wheel. Toggle instantly between the thrill of the drive and a mobile lounge—the choice is finally yours.
|
Open Source for Physical AI
We’ve launched OpenTau, the first open-source foundation model for "Physical AI." By sharing our VLA robotics tech with the world, we aren't just building a car—we're setting the new global standard for industry safety.
